The three key processes that form part of an organism's metabolism are catabolism, anabolism, and energy transfer. Catabolism involves the breakdown of complex molecules into simpler ones, releasing energy in the process. Anabolism, on the other hand, refers to the synthesis of complex molecules from simpler ones, requiring energy input. Energy transfer encompasses the conversion and utilization of energy derived from these metabolic processes to fuel cellular activities and maintain homeostasis.
An individual form of life that uses energy to carry out life activities is called an organism. Organisms can be anything from single-celled bacteria to complex multicellular organisms like plants and animals.
atoms and molecules --> cell --> tissue --> organ --> organ system --> organism
